Overview

Gritty and real. This is a semi-biographical book with all the nuances of family life in 1930s London. A life of love, loss, hard times, and surprisingly good times as we follow the good-looking and sexy Geoffrey's adventures at war-complimented and balanced against his life as a boy growing into manhood with his naughty girls down the pub and his thoughtless hedonistic ways. We meet his mum and sister who try to teach him manners, his adored deceased wife, their young children, and their stepmother. This book is coloured by the life his motherless children have to live, along with the people of London, France, Algeria, and Italy. It also paints how Geoffrey harbours a dark and painful secret.
